The Claude Power Move (CPM) Method
The CPM approach is a structured, step-by-step technique designed to tackle complex problems using AGI. The method entails formulating abstract ideas like, "Help me create a step-by-step plan to <do x> in order to accomplish <y goal>". By channeling this query to advanced reasoning engines like sonnet 3.5, users can receive insightful outputs that guide them through the intricacies of their objectives.
Once the reasoning engine processes the initial request, the output can be further refined using creative engines like opus. This iterative process allows for the generation of multiple variations on the initial idea, enhancing creativity and depth. Users can then select the best option, refine it, and ensure it effectively accomplishes the stated goal. Although heavy usage of these engines can quickly exhaust daily message quotas, the payoff in terms of strategic planning and execution is significant, particularly for complex tasks.
AGI and Economies of Scale
The potential of AGI goes beyond individual productivity; it has profound implications for the scale and coordination of economic activities. Traditional companies often experience diseconomies of scale due to increasing coordination costs as they grow. However, AGIs can operate with a different set of dynamics. By aligning the utility functions of various AGIs, they can coordinate at unprecedented levels of efficiency, merging their interests and operations without the friction that typically arises in human-led organizations.
Imagine a scenario where entire industries are managed by AGIs that function under a unified intent. This model could drastically reduce internal coordination costs related to value discrepancies, asymmetric information, and principal-agent problems. The result would be companies that not only grow larger but also operate more efficiently, potentially leading to monopolistic structures that could reshape entire sectors.
The Nationalization of Resources
As countries recognize the potential competitive advantage of AGI-controlled economies, there may be a trend toward nationalizing productive resources under a singular AGI. This move could allow nations to outpace others that are slower to adopt such transformative technologies. By employing an AGI that is intent-aligned to a governing body or a small group of humans, nations could streamline operations and resource allocation, creating a significant edge in global markets.
However, this anticipated shift raises ethical and practical considerations. The prospect of a single AGI controlling vast economic resources poses questions about accountability, governance, and the potential for abuse of power. Therefore, it is crucial for policymakers to navigate these challenges thoughtfully.
